Dive into the intense world of Double Clash, a strategic 2v2 gaming showdown where teamwork and skill are critical. Assemble your squad and prepare to battle against other talented teams in legendary showdowns. Will https://xanderuqpl427105.pointblog.net/gaming-a-2v2-challenge-90283014